**Philosopher’s Club**
I know I am a primate
When I feel most primal,
And not my primary instinct
Is to try to think...
But can a caveman
Escape the allegorical cave
In an era of man caves?
I sit upon the philosopher’s stone,
For a philosopher-king has
No better throne—
And this throne has no games.
Paradoxes and puzzles
Are what we play
In the Philosopher’s Club.
No sophists allowed—
And those who dare invade,
Best be afraid.
For they that tread herein
Risk, in coming,
To be bludgeoned
With wit and cunning,
With lyric and logic—
To be beaten,
And brutalized...
By a Philosopher’s Club.
*Boop.*
— Y. Pessoa
